易语言是一种专为中国人设计的编程语言,它以简明直观的中文编程语法著称,降低了编程的门槛,使得更多的人能够接触并学习编程。在易语言中进行Excel数据的导入是一项常见的操作,尤其在处理大量数据时,利用Excel的数据处理能力能极大地提高程序效率。以下将详细介绍易语言中实现Excel导入的相关知识点。 1. **Excel文件格式**:Excel文件通常以.xlsx或.xls为扩展名,是Microsoft Office中的电子表格应用,用于组织、计算和分析数据。在易语言中,我们主要关注如何读取这些文件中的数据。 2. **易语言库支持**:易语言提供了多种库来支持与Excel文件的交互,如“通用API调用”库、“.NET组件”库等。其中,“.NET组件”库常用于调用.NET Framework中的Microsoft.Office.Interop.Excel命名空间,以实现对Excel文件的操作。 3. **使用通用API调用**:易语言中的“通用API调用”库允许开发者直接调用Windows API函数,如使用OpenFile、CreateFile等函数打开和读取Excel文件。但这种方式需要对Windows API有深入理解,对于初学者来说难度较大。 4. **使用.NET组件**:更常用的方法是通过易语言的“.NET组件”库调用Excel的COM组件。需要在易语言环境中添加引用到Microsoft.Office.Interop.Excel组件,然后通过对象实例化创建Excel应用程序对象,再打开工作簿,读取工作表中的数据。 5. **代码示例**: - 创建Excel对象:`.NET组件.创建对象("Microsoft.Office.Interop.Excel.Application")` - 打开Excel文件:`对象.工作簿.打开("C:\path\to\your\file.xlsx")` - 访问工作表:`工作簿.工作表[1]` - 读取单元格数据:`工作表.范围["A1"].Value` 6. **数据处理**:读取到Excel数据后,可以将其存储在易语言的数据结构中,如数组、列表等,以便进一步处理或显示。需要注意的是,Excel的数据可能包含日期、公式、文本等多种类型,需要根据实际需求进行转换和处理。 7. **错误处理**:在操作过程中,可能会遇到文件不存在、权限不足等问题,因此需要编写适当的错误处理代码,确保程序在出现问题时能够优雅地处理,而不是崩溃。 8. **资源释放**:完成数据读取后,记得关闭工作簿和释放Excel对象,防止资源泄露。可以使用`工作簿.关闭()`和`.NET组件.销毁对象()`方法。 9. **性能优化**:如果处理大量数据,可以考虑一次性读取整个工作表,或者采用多线程技术提高读取速度。 10. **学习资源**:易语言社区和论坛提供了许多关于Excel导入的教程和示例代码,新手可以通过学习这些资源快速掌握相关技能。 易语言Excel导入涉及到了对象实例化、文件操作、数据读取与转换等多个方面,通过熟练掌握相关知识点,开发者可以方便地在易语言程序中实现Excel数据的导入和处理。
2026-04-16 08:59:42 19KB 易语言excel导入源码 excel导入
1
易语言EXCEL表导入EDB数据库源码 系统结构:是否存在指定数据表,转换字母,随机生成密码, ======窗口程序集1 | | | |------ __启动窗口_创建完毕 | | | |------ _按钮xls_被单击 | | | |------ _按钮mdb
1
易语言EXCEL表格对象操作类2.3模块源码,EXCEL表格对象操作类2.3模块,test,test2,test3,到变体,RGB,取分隔串内容,cell,cells,列名转数字,数字转列名,取Application,取Creator,取Parent,取Parent变体,取自动缩进,置自动缩进,取区域,取AddressLocal,取Areas,取Bo
1
主要是对超级列表框数据的操作 含导入、导出、排序等功能。支持Excel、文本文档快速导出。 1万数据。Excel导入导出1秒左右。
2024-06-01 17:05:38 10KB 易语言例程
1
xlwings能够非常方便的读写Excel文件中的数据,并且能够进行单元格格式的修改;xlwings可以和matplotlib以及pandas无缝连接;xlwings还可以调用Excel文件中VBA写好的程序,也可以让VBA调用用Python写的程序;xlwings开源免费并一直在更新。本文为PDF版的xlwings的操作手册
2024-05-06 21:45:36 819KB python 开发语言 Excel
1
易语言Excel多表对应处理源码,Excel多表对应处理,取分表姓名分数,对应姓名查找
1
易语言EXCEL另存为CSV文件源码,EXCEL另存为CSV文件
1
易语言excel多列排序源码,excel多列排序,Excel排序,数字到字母,关键字处理
1
易语言EXcel 过滤器源码,EXcel 过滤器,窗口位置设置,等待设置,调用Excel程序,读设置文件到组合框,气球提示,读取对象属性,删除列排序,清除数据,设置选择框,消息框,设置单元格,读单元格内容,删除行,删除列,检查输入内容,取表格列数,过滤删除行,过滤删除列,前移
2023-02-25 14:27:44 28KB 易语言EXcel 过滤器源码 EXcel 过滤器
1
EXCEL文件导入导出到高级表格源码例程
2022-11-21 14:18:50 231KB 易语言 Excel
1